The Texas Department of Transportation has issued a solicitation for a local let maintenance contract to supply and apply winter weather materials along Interstate Highway 0027 in Randall County, Texas, with an estimated contract value of $376,804.50. The solicitation, numbered 6507-25-001_0826, was posted on July 22, 2026, with bids due by August 20, 2026, and is part of a streamlined procurement process designated as “waived,” indicating it follows simplified procedures under TxDOT’s local let program. Performance is to be completed within 120 calendar days following contract award, with work spanning multiple locations along the designated highway corridor as detailed in referenced plan sheets. The contract includes a $8,000 performance guaranty, and payment will be administered by the Amarillo District Maintenance Contract Office, though specific invoicing systems and payment methods are not outlined.
